November 28th, 2015, in accordance with the work plan of the Scientific-Research Institute for Law and the Day of Open Doors of NAU, Department of Theory and History of State and Law held a round table with the participation of students of secondary schools in the city of Kiev «Legal education as a basis of the rule of law».
The roundtable was attended by Director of the UN Law Institute Irina pipe, Head of the Department of Theory and History of State and Law Ivan Borodin, teachers, students and pupils of high schools and secondary schools in the city of Kiev and regions of Ukraine. An interesting element of the meeting was the presentation of the legal class of lyceum students number 227 named after NN Gromova, who in their speeches expressed their understanding of the formation of the rule of law in Ukraine. Students of the Institute told the future entrants about the kinds of legal professions in Ukraine. During the roundtable, present also received information about the benefits of training in UN Law Institute of NAU, the prestige of the legal profession. Such activities promote career guidance to individual personality development, the formation of citizenship and legal culture of young people, helping to determine the future profession.
